About the Role
As a Senior Software Engineer, you will drive the development of critical systems that power how users join and trust our platform; spanning user acquisition, onboarding, identity, and fraud prevention. You will collaborate with cross-functional teams to deliver reliable, scalable, and high-performance software solutions. This role requires a deep understanding of software engineering principles and the ambition to lead impactful projects.
In this role, you will:
Lead the architecture and design of platform systems that support user acquisition, onboarding, and identity infrastructure.
Build and scale fraud prevention systems to protect the integrity of our platform.
Develop high-quality code and implement robust testing strategies to ensure product reliability.
Collaborate with product managers and designers to create seamless user experiences from first touch through activation.
Mentor junior engineers to foster technical growth and innovation.
Desired Capabilities
5+ years of software engineering experience, with a backend-leaning full stack orientation.
Strong proficiency in programming languages such as Java, Python, or Ruby to deliver robust solutions.
Experience building platforms and scalable infrastructure systems.
Experience with cloud platforms like AWS or Azure to enable scalable applications.
Demonstrated ability to lead technical projects and drive them to success.
Excellent problem-solving skills to address complex technical challenges.
Excellent communication skills to effectively collaborate with diverse teams.
Extra Credit
Interest in identity, trust & safety, or fraud prevention.

What you need to know about the San Francisco Tech Scene
Key Facts About San Francisco Tech
- Number of Tech Workers: 365,500; 13.9%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
- Major Tech Employers: Google, Apple, Salesforce, Meta
-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, cloud computing, fintech, consumer technology, software
- Funding Landscape: $50.5 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
- Notable Investors: Sequoia Capital, Andreessen Horowitz, Bessemer Venture Partners, Greylock Partners, Khosla Ventures, Kleiner Perkins
- Research Centers and Universities: Stanford University; University of California, Berkeley; University of San Francisco; Santa Clara University; Ames Research Center; Center for AI Safety; California Institute for Regenerative Medicine
